I. Brief Introduction to China Scholastic Competency Assessment (CSCA)
Starting from the academic year 2026/2027, international students applying for undergraduate programs at Chinese government scholarship universities /institutions must take the test before submitting their applications. The test results should be one of the necessary materials for each university/institution to review and admit students. University/institutions and applicants can visit the official website of CSCA (www.csca.cn) for more information. The first global exam of CSCA will be launched on December 21, 2025. From 2026, a fixed examination cycle will be formed, with exams organized five times a year: in January, March, April, June, and December every year. The test subjects include: professional Chinese, mathematics, physics and chemistry.
Professional Chinese offers two types of tests: liberal arts Chinese and science Chinese. Applicants applying for undergraduate programs taught in Chinese should take the corresponding direction of professional Chinese test based on the category of the applied major. Applicants applying for English-taught undergraduate programs do not need to take the professional Chinese test; applicants applying for a bachelor's degree in Chinese language can be exempted from the professional Chinese test if they can provide a valid HSK Level 4 score report. In the basic subjects, regardless of the applied major, mathematics is a compulsory subject; in addition, applicants for science, engineering, agriculture, and medicine-related majors are generally required to choose at least one of the above two subjects -- physics or chemistry. The test for mathematics, physics and chemistry are provided in both Chinese and English, and applicants can choose the language of the test according to the teaching language requirements.
